| Are there any major differences between commerce server 2000/2002/2007? Particulalry if someone has a good background in one is it easily transferable to the others? thanks, James |

| Many improvements have been made on CS from 2000 to 2007. The greatest improvement is seperating Business Applications from each other. On 2002 version there were BizDesk which was webBased catalog, order, and marketing manager that was an all in one package. Seperating each one and having webServices for each system made commerce life easier. Now we have Catalog Manager, Marketing Manager, Customer and Orders Manager applications, all are windows forms applications that means they work fast.
